The MIM Method
Material
While research continues for widening the scope of materials available for MIM, the following materials are offered today:
low alloy steel and stainlless steel, soft magnetic materials, controlled thermal expansion and sealing, ultra high strength alloy steel.
It is important to match the properties of these materials with the engineering needs of the customer, in order to choose the most suitable material.

Main Categories in MIM
Stainless Steel:
AISI 316L (DIN 1.4436.1.4404), AISI 304L (DIN 1.4306)
AISI 420 (DIN 1.4021), AISI 440C (DIN 1.4125)
AISI 430L (DIN 1.4016), AISI 17-4PH (DIN 1.4542,1.4548)
Ultra High strenght Low Alloy Steel:
AISI 4340 (DIN 1.6565)
AISI 4140 (DIN 1.7225)
AISI H13 (DIN 1.2344)
Low Alloy Steel:
7% Ni-Fe
2% Ni-Fe
AISI 8620 (DIN 1.6543, 1.6523, 1.6526)
Soft Magnetic Materials:
2% Ni-Fe, 40% Ni-Fe, 50% Ni-Fe (DIN 1.3927),
80% Ni-Fe, 3% Si-Fe, 7% Si-Fe, Iron, 2V Permendur,
AISI 430L (DIN 1.4016)
Controlled Expansion & Sealing Materials:
36% Ni-Fe (Invar)
42% Ni-Fe
ASTM F 15 (Kovar)
Other Materials:
Copper
Brass
Titanium
